首页 > TAG信息列表 > 19

P5628 【AFOI-19】面基 (dp + 容斥)

P5628 【AFOI-19】面基 (dp + 容斥) 题目传送门 题目大意:略 题目分析: 首先我们观察数据范围,我们发现给定的图是一棵树,那么我们可以直接 \(dfs\) 来计算重要度,根据乘法原理可知。对于某条边的重要度为边两侧的节点个数的乘积。 接下来我们考虑用 \(dp\) 来进行求解,我们令 \(f_{i,j}\)

力扣19(java&python)-删除链表的倒数第 N 个结点(中等)

题目: 给你一个链表,删除链表的倒数第 n 个结点,并且返回链表的头结点。 示例 1: 输入:head = [1,2,3,4,5], n = 2 输出:[1,2,3,5] 示例2: 输入:head = [1], n = 1 输出:[] 示例 3: 输入:head = [1,2], n = 1 输出:[1] 提示: 链表中结点的数目为 sz 1 <= sz <= 30 0 <= Node.val <= 100 1 <

大流行的教训:多条路径,多机会

大流行的教训:多条路径,多机会 在设计阶段增加竞争将有助于按时按预算交付基础设施 “在每一次危机中,都蕴藏着巨大的机遇” 阿尔伯特爱因斯坦曾经说过,我们对 COVID-19 的回应证明了这一点。 传统药物的开发速度非常缓慢。从 2010 年到 2020 年,从首次提交到监管机构批准的平均时间超

大流行的教训:多条路径,多机会

大流行的教训:多条路径,多机会 在设计阶段增加竞争将有助于按时按预算交付基础设施 “在每一次危机中,都蕴藏着巨大的机遇” 阿尔伯特爱因斯坦曾经说过,我们对 COVID-19 的回应证明了这一点。 传统药物的开发速度非常缓慢。从 2010 年到 2020 年,从首次提交到监管机构批准的平均时间超

19.CSRF跨站请求伪造

一.概述 1.定义 Crose-Site Request Forgerry,跨站请求伪造,攻击者利用服务器对用户的信任,从而欺骗受害者去服务器上执行受害者不知情的请求。 在CSRF的攻击场景中,攻击者会伪造一个请求(一般为链接),然后欺骗用户进行点击。用户一旦点击,整个攻击也就完成了。所以 CSRF攻击也被成为“one

MySQL 视图、函数、存储过程、触发器、事件(了解即可)

1.视图:view 视图就是一张虚拟的表。表是真正存数据的,视图只是显示查询结果。 视图的作用:隐藏表的结构、简化sql嵌套查询操作 注意:视图就是你要查询数据的一个中间结果集,我们一般只用来做数据查询的 创建视图:create view view_name as 查询语句 例如: mysql> create view v_na

第 19 题:React setState 笔试题,下面的代码输出什么?

```js class Example extends React.Component { constructor() { super(); this.state = { val: 0 }; } componentDidMount() { this.setState({val: this.state.val + 1}); console.log(this.state.val); // 第 1 次 log this.se

19.rsync工具

rsync用作数据镜像备份工具 服务端安装部署(192.168.157.136) 安装rsync和xinetd yum -y install rsync.x86_64 yum -y install xinetd xinetd作为管理操作系统中不频繁使用的服务(有请求才运行该服务),减少对资源的占用 修改xinetd配置文件 vi /etc/xinetd.d/rsync servi

LeetCode 19 组合总和

class Solution { public: vector<vector<int>> res; vector<int> path; int sum = 0; void dfs(int start, vector<int>& candidates, int target) { if (sum > target) return; if (sum == target) {

第 19 天:实施三枪强化

第 19 天:实施三枪强化 客观的 :我们如何在计时器上设置我们的三连发加电,使其持续有限的时间? 所以现在我已经了解了三连击加电是什么,让我们开始实施这些行为以及它何时变得活跃!首先,我们想要 创建一个新的精灵,暗示它是三枪通电 当我们收集它时。我想确保我 设置对撞机并确保通过我们

从零开始配置vim(19)——终端配置

在上一篇文章中,我们熟悉了终端模式,并且配置了终端模式的一些操作。但是它总是有那么一点不符合我们的使用习惯。这篇我们将通过强大的插件来完善终端操作的体验。 在介绍插件之前让我们先回退到上一个版本,我们把上一篇文章中的配置全部从配置文件中剔除。先别着急喷我把各位小伙伴

Discuz上传图片UploadError:500错误解决方法 (2019-06-12 19:42:28)

环境为IIS下的 winserverr2008 换了服务器后,上传图片的时候,显示上传100%,然后报错:upload error: 500.怎么回事那? 忙活了一晚上,一直找不到问题所在、百度看了好多都是更改PHP上传大小配置之类的。不起任何作用、最后找到了这个解决办法可以了 【解决方法】 原来是php上传文件的时

UOJ #515. 【UR #19】前进四

题面传送门 UOJ是真的引领时代潮流。 首先显然有一个线段树维护区间单调栈的方法,但是是\(O(m\log ^2n)\)的并不够优秀。因为我们不需要知道区间的信息,我们只需要知道后缀的信息。 考虑离线,按照序列顺序从后往前维护时间轴,每次相当于区间取\(\min\),以及单点询问被真正取\(\min\)的

用python画出网格图与路线图

    import matplotlib.pyplot as plt import numpy as np from matplotlib.pyplot import MultipleLocator import copy import pylab import random network = [[0,0,0,0,0,0,1,1,1,0,0,0,0,0,0,0,0,0,0,0], [0,1,1,0,1,0,1,1,1,0,0,0,1,1,1,1,0,0,0,0],

2022-08-19 PreparedStatement

PreparedStatement PreparedStatement接口是Statement的子接口,它表示一条预编译过的SQL语句 什么是SQL注入 SQL注入是利用某些系统没有对用户输入的数据进行充分的检查,而在用户输入数据中注入非法的SQL语句段或命令,从而利用系统的SQL引擎完成恶意行为的做法。 preparedstatement

【2022.8.19】MySQL数据库(6)

学习内容概要 视图 触发器 存储过程 事物 内置函数 流程控制、循环结构 索引与慢查询 内容详细 视图 解释:SQL语句执行的结果为一张虚拟表 我们基于这张虚拟表去做其他操作 含义:如果需要频繁的使用这张基于SQL语句执行后得出的这张虚拟表 我们可以将这张虚拟表 保存起来 我

pandas数据处理(二)

简单研究下读取mysql、查询、分组、聚合、绘图。 其还有窗口函数等更加复杂的操作,暂时不做研究。 1. 准备数据 DROP TABLE IF EXISTS `t_user_log`; CREATE TABLE `t_user_log` ( `id` int(11) NOT NULL AUTO_INCREMENT, `username` varchar(255) CHARACTER SET utf8 COLLATE

日常小随笔(其一)

8月19日 虽然是8月20日编辑的文案但毕竟是19日就已经想到了 姑且算作19日吧 突然意识到吉林太美可以写作鸡您太美(吉林加10度) 这是在鸡你太美的基础上更有礼貌的表达 优雅,实在是太优雅了 对只因您大学好感度瞬间上升了ヽ(✿゚▽゚)ノ  

22.8.19

22.8.19 ABC256_H 题意: 要求实现三种操作 将区间 \(L\) 到 \(R\) 中的数变为 \(\lfloor \frac{a_i}{x}\rfloor\) 将区间 \(L\) 到 \(R\) 中的数变为 \(x\) 查询 \(L\) 到 \(R\) 的区间和 思路: \(x\geq2\), 那么考虑一个数最多做 \(log\) 次操作一, 对于操作二, 最多将势能

2022-08-19 第五组 赖哲栋 学习笔记

Statement的不足 大量的字符串拼接,代码可读性降低 sql注入 PreparedStatement 预编译(预加载) 接口 通过conn获取的对象 是statement接口的子接口 sql语句中可以传参。用?占位,通过setXXX方法来给?赋值 提供性能 避免sql注入 -------更新数据 @Test public void test01

2022-08-19 第八组 卢睿 学习心得

目录JDBCStatement的不足SQL注入PreparedStatement:预编译(预加载)接口案例ResultSetMetaData(了解即可)数据库事务Mysql的数据库引擎4事务的四大特征ACID原子性 A。一致性 C。隔离性 Isolation持久性 D术语操作事务的步骤 JDBC Statement的不足 大量的字符串拼接,代码可读性降低。 s

【2022-08-19】mysql基础知识(六)

mysql基础知识(六) mysql之视图view 什么是视图? 视图就是通过查询得到的一张虚拟表,然后保存下来,下次直接进行使用即可。 即:将SQL语句的查询结果当做虚拟表保存起来,以后可以反复进行使用 视图的作用? 如果要频繁使用一张虚拟表,那么通过视图的方式就可以不用重复查询 比如:我们来

2022-08-19 第四小组 王星苹 学习笔记

学习心得 PreparedStatement,预编译(预加载)接口 1.通过conn获取的对象 2.是Statement接口的子接口 3.sql语句中可以传参,用? 来占位,通过setxxx方法给?赋值 4.提高性能   掌握情况 工具类有连接数据库还有关闭IO流,还有一些其他的操作,这样可以直接调用,省去了很多时间 总

[一、基础语法]19流程控制:breake,continue,return循环控制语句的使用

热烈欢迎,请直接点击!!! 进入博主App Store主页,下载使用各个作品!!! 注:博主将坚持每月上线一个新app!!!

[八、精彩实例]19制作个人理财档案页面

热烈欢迎,请直接点击!!! 进入博主App Store主页,下载使用各个作品!!! 注:博主将坚持每月上线一个新app!!!